Ebay takes aim at luxury market with Spring partnership

Published
Sep 14, 2017

Ebay has partnered with Groupe Arnault-backed luxury e-tailer Spring to create a curated storefront on the site, allowing access to brands like Saint Laurent, Prada, and Chloé.




"The Spring and eBay partnership is evidence of a growing trend in which retailers are partnering – instead of competing – with other retailers," said Jill Ramsey, Vice President of Merchandising at Ebay.

The partnership with Spring helps Ebay by bringing coveted brands onto one landing page. Spring's assortment includes jewelry, apparel, accessories and footwear. Brands carried include Missoni and Free People, as well as Bobbi Brown and Vans.

Alan Tisch, Founder & CEO of Spring said that "Spring's mission is to bring top brands to consumers at a variety of tastes, style and prices."

Tisch noted that partnering with Ebay expands Spring's reach significantly. Ebay has over 171 million active buyers and 370 million downloads of its apps. 88% of merchandise on Ebay is sold through the Buy It Now feature which does not involve bidding.

Spring has been an Ebay member since May of this year and sells under the name Shop Spring. It currently has 500 followers, however with the official partnership and creation of a storefront that number will grow quickly.
